Multiple choice
Decide which option is correct.
1. I like my homework carefully before I go to shool.

A. doing B. did C. to do D. not to do

Note : Like takes a to – infinitive when it means that we prefer


something even though we may not enjoy it.
Like usually takes an ing – form when we use it to talk about
hobbies and interests. Ex : Mary likes swimming.

Rewrite the sentence
3. She remembered an email to her boss last week.
( send )
She remembered sending an email to her boss last week.

Note : - We use remember/ forget to do for necessary actions. The


remembering is before the action.
- We use remember/ forget doing for memories of the past.
The action is before the remembering.

Multiple choice
Decide which option is correct.
4. We regret you that we stop our event because of
our problem.
A. to inform B. informing C. not to inform D. informed

Note : Regret to do sth means to be sorry for sth you are


doing.
Regret doing sth means to be sorry because of sth
that happened in the past.

True or False
5. I invited Linda joining my birthday party.
False
Verb order : joining

Note : V + O + to – inf with verbs : Invite, advise, allow,


ask, encourage, expect, remind, teach, etc .
V + O + -ing form with verbs : dislike, imagine,
keep, involve, stop, mind, etc .

True / False
5. There’s a phone upstairs. I can hear it ring.
 False
Note : We use the infinitive after these verbs to express that we
heard or saw the entire action or event.
We use the V-ing form to show that we hear or see an action
or event going on.
 There’s a phone upstairs. I can hear it ringing.
(Có điện thoại trên lầu. Tôi có thể nghe thấy nó đang đổ chuông).
